About Consumer Rights Law in Ikorodu, Nigeria:
Consumer Rights in Ikorodu, Nigeria are governed by various laws and regulations that aim to protect the rights of consumers in transactions with businesses. These laws ensure fair treatment, quality products, and accurate information for consumers.

Local Laws Overview:
The Consumer Protection Council of Nigeria is tasked with enforcing consumer rights laws in Ikorodu. Key laws include the Consumer Protection Council Act and the Sale of Goods Act. These laws protect consumers from misleading advertisements, unsafe products, and unfair practices by businesses.
Frequently Asked Questions:
1. What are my rights as a consumer in Ikorodu?
Consumers in Ikorodu have the right to safety, information, choice, and redress. These rights ensure that you receive quality products, accurate information, and fair treatment in transactions.
2. How can I file a complaint against a business for violating my consumer rights?
You can file a complaint with the Consumer Protection Council of Nigeria. They will investigate the matter and take appropriate action against the business if they find a violation of consumer rights.
3. Can I sue a business for selling me a defective product in Ikorodu?
Yes, you can sue a business for selling you a defective product in Ikorodu. A lawyer can help you pursue a product liability claim and seek compensation for any damages or injuries caused by the defective product.
